NTNU is the Norwegian University of Science and Technology. It offers various study programs, including PhD, Master's, and undergraduate programs. The university also provides opportunities for exchange students and refugees. NTNU has research facilities and supports researchers. It has a library, museum, and alumni network, along with news and media services.
